A global financial services firm based in Greater London is seeking a Senior .NET Developer to lead innovative greenfield projects in a hybrid working environment.
The ideal candidate will bring over 8 years of software development experience with strong skills in .NET, C#, SQL Server, and Azure.
You will be part of a supportive, agile team where your contributions matter. Enjoy opportunities for professional growth and a diverse, inclusive culture, along with competitive benefits including private medical for you and your family.
